What Is AEO? The Definitive Guide to Answer Engine Optimization

AEO (Answer Engine Optimization) is the process of optimizing digital content to be selected, cited, and recommended as the direct answer by AI-driven answer engines and generative search systems. Unlike traditional search engines that return a ranked list of blue links, answer engines synthesize unstructured web information into concise conversational responses.

If you are asking what is AEO, you are observing a fundamental shift in search behavior: search is transitioning from retrieval to synthesis. When prospective buyers query engines like ChatGPT, Perplexity, Google AI Overviews, Gemini, and DeepSeek, they rarely click through ten distinct web pages. Instead, they consume synthesized recommendations. Optimizing for this paradigm requires understanding how Large Language Models (LLMs) and Retrieval-Augmented Generation (RAG) systems ingest, process, and attribute information.


How Answer Engines Work: The Technical Pipeline

To optimize for answer engines, marketers must look past traditional ranking algorithms and understand how neural retrieval models evaluate content. Modern AI answer engines rely on a three-stage pipeline to generate answers:

1. Semantic Retrieval and Dense Vectors

Traditional search relies heavily on lexical matching (matching exact words like "best CRM software"). Answer engines translate user prompts into multi-dimensional mathematical vectors (embeddings) to capture intent. 2. Passage Chunking and Context Windows

LLMs do not ingest full 3,000-word articles in a single glance during real-time retrieval. Instead, retrieval systems break documents into smaller "chunks" (typically 200–500 tokens). If an individual passage cannot stand on its own with clear contextual entity relationships, the model discards it during re-ranking. 3. Synthesis and Attribution

Once the top context passages are retrieved, the foundation model synthesizes a coherent answer. If the engine operates with live retrieval (such as Perplexity or ChatGPT with Search), it generates inline citations pointing back to the source chunks that supplied the key facts.


AEO vs. Traditional SEO: Key Differences Compared

While Answer Engine Optimization builds upon foundational SEO principles (like crawlability and factual authority), its execution and success metrics differ significantly.

Dimension Traditional SEO Answer Engine Optimization (AEO)
Primary Goal Rank on Page 1 of Search Engine Results Pages (SERPs) Earn direct citations and brand recommendations in synthesized answers
User Interface List of 10 organic blue links + rich snippets Single conversational answer with inline source cards/footnotes
Target Mechanism Keyword density, backlink equity, PageRank Semantic vector similarity, entity authority, passage-level clarity
Content Unit Entire URLs / comprehensive landing pages Discrete, self-contained factual chunks (Passage Engineering)
Primary Metric Organic impressions, keyword rank, organic clicks AI Share of Voice (SOV), citation frequency, sentiment score
Traffic Pattern Direct referral click-throughs to website Zero-click answer consumption + high-intent downstream discovery

Traditional SEO prioritizes driving a user to your site so they can find the answer. AEO prioritizes delivering the answer directly to the model so your brand is established as the authority, leading to downstream preference during buying decisions. Why Answer Engine Optimization Is Crucial for Brands

The rapid adoption of AI search assistants has permanently altered the B2B and SaaS research cycle. Here is why proactive AEO is now essential:

1. The Proliferation of Zero-Click Search

As generative interfaces summarize product comparisons, feature matrices, and technical definitions directly on the search results screen, organic click-through rates for informational queries decline. If your brand is not cited in the AI summary, you become invisible to buyers who never click past the generated response.

2. AI Recommendation Bias in Product Shortlists

When a buyer asks an AI engine, "What are the top enterprise visibility monitoring tools?", the model generates a shortlist of 3 to 5 vendors. Being included on that generative shortlist creates an immediate halo effect. If an AI engine omits your product or hallucinates incorrect positioning (e.g., categorizing an enterprise platform as a freelancer tool), you lose pipeline before the prospect ever visits your site.

3. Multi-Engine Fragmentation

Search is no longer a single-platform channel dominated solely by Google. Users research workflows across ChatGPT, Perplexity, Gemini, Claude, and DeepSeek. Each engine utilizes distinct retrieval models, training cuts, and web scrapers. A unified AEO strategy ensures consistent brand positioning across all major language models.

1. Direct-Answer Passage Engineering

Answer engines favor unambiguous answers. Structure high-value pages with clear question-based headings followed immediately by a 40–60 word direct definition or answer. Avoid burying core conclusions beneath narrative introductions.

  • State the subject and predicate clearly.
  • Use bulleted lists for multi-step processes or attribute matrices.
  • Ensure every sub-section can be understood if extracted completely out of context.

2. Third-Party Entity Validation

LLMs do not rely solely on your self-published claims; they triangulate facts across the broader digital ecosystem. If your website claims your software supports SOC 2 compliance, but review directories, technical forums, and industry publications do not mention it, the model’s confidence score drops. Cultivate brand mentions across authoritative review sites, media publications, and technical documentation hubs.

3. Active AI Share of Voice (SOV) Monitoring

Because AI answers are non-deterministic and update continuously based on live web retrieval and fine-tuning, static rank tracking cannot capture your AI visibility. Brands must measure how often they are mentioned, how frequently they are cited as a reference link, and what sentiment accompanies those mentions across different platforms. How to Measure and Track AEO Performance

Tracking AEO success requires monitoring new key performance indicators (KPIs) tailored to generative engines:

+-------------------+---------------------------------------------------------+
| AEO Metric        | What It Measures                                        |
+-------------------+---------------------------------------------------------+
| AI Mention Rate   | Percentage of target prompts where your brand appears   |
| Citation Share    | How often your domain URL is linked as an active source |
| Sentiment / Tone  | Whether the model describes your product favorably      |
| Engine Coverage   | Visibility balance across ChatGPT, Perplexity, etc.    |
+-------------------+---------------------------------------------------------+
  1. AI Mention Rate: The percentage of target industry queries where an AI engine explicitly includes your brand in its generated response.
  2. Citation Frequency: How frequently your website’s specific URLs are included in the source footnotes or reference cards of RAG engines.
  3. Sentiment & Positioning Alignment: Evaluating whether the AI engine accurately identifies your target audience, core pricing tier, and primary features without hallucination.
  4. Competitor Gap Analysis: Comparing your brand’s presence against competitors inside the same prompt ecosystem.

Frequently Asked Questions About AEO

Is AEO replacing SEO?

No. AEO does not replace SEO; it builds directly upon it. Traditional SEO ensures search crawlers can index and understand your pages, while AEO ensures that AI models can extract, contextualize, and cite your content within generative answers. Both strategies work together.

How do answer engines choose which sites to cite?

Answer engines select sources by evaluating semantic relevance, entity authority, and structural extractability. When a query triggers a real-time web search (via RAG), the engine retrieves passages with high vector similarity scores, validates facts across independent sources, and synthesizes answers using the most clear, factual passages available.

What is the difference between AEO and GEO (Generative Engine Optimization)?

The terms are often used interchangeably. AEO (Answer Engine Optimization) emphasizes providing direct, structured solutions to specific questions, whereas GEO (Generative Engine Optimization) encompasses broader optimization strategies across all generative AI outputs, including creative generation, code synthesis, and multi-modal answers.

Can schema markup help improve AEO?

Yes. Structured data (such as Schema.org Article, Product, Organization, and FAQPage markup) helps machine readers and AI crawlers map entity relationships with high precision, reducing ambiguity when the model ingests your web pages.
